Objective
Students are able to combine knowledge obtained from imaging methods and palpation findings. They deepen their competence and apply knowledge and skills of topographic and regional anatomy acquired in previous studies.Student names the anatomical structures of the skull. Students understand the significance of radiological diagnostics to diagnosing and treating illnesses. They have a general view of the use of radiological procedures and their significance to patients’ treatment.
Content
Examination of the size, shape and location of the structures of the human body as well as a detailed examination of the clinically significant areas: microscopy, anatomical dissection, sonopalpation.
Radiology:
Principles of imaging diagnostics (radiography, computed tomography, ultrasound, magnetic resonance imaging, nuclear scan).
Anatomy of the skull.
